Effective Monday, responsibility for the Murmura museum audio-guide app moves off my plate. This covers the tour playback service, offline bundle pipeline, and the beacon-triggered narration feature. Paging rules are unchanged: sev-1 for playback outages during open hours, sev-2 otherwise. The runbook has been updated; the stale section on bundle invalidation is now accurate. Open incidents transfer as-is; the exhibit-sync flakiness ticket is the only active one. From Monday, route all escalations to the new owner named below.

account owner for tahof-fajef: Holax Druir Fraiel Wenir

## Authentication

Wikiwarden's role-based access sounds fancy, but under the hood it's simple: every request to the Gategrove permissions service carries a service key, and Gategrove answers with the caller's role map. No key, no roles, no page — editors and readers alike get bounced to the login stub.

A heads-up for future maintainers: the dev key and the prod key look identical in length, so label your env files clearly. For local development, Gategrove accepts the key below.

API key for yahig-tadup: kto7_ubizbYm

Handover — Budget Request (Incoming Director)

The pending request covers expansion of the Marnell lab: staffing, two analyzers, and facility works. Finance asked for a revised phasing; draft is with Tomas Reeve. Board review is next cycle. Approve the phasing before resubmitting. The rationale tied to wider plans is set out in the note below.

management briefing: The renewal with Zoraelax Group closes at $10 million a year, 15 percent below the last contract. Project Ralael slips by six weeks because of the audit delay.

Subject: Handover — Slimline image work

Hi Daro,

Handing off the container-slimming effort on the Bramblecore fleet. Goal: base images under 120 MB. We strip build tools in a final stage and prune locales. Layer-size metrics per build get written to a tracking table so we can chart regressions — don't skip that step. Scripts are in the ops repo under slimline/. The metrics database is reachable with the connection string below.

primary connection of yagep-kahip = redis://giliel_svc:zYiKsLL2PLpfPL@db-348f.xolmarsys.corp:5432/fenwyn